Protecting Your Kidneys - The Antioxidant Benefits of Vitamin C

 Chronic kidney disease (CKD) poses significant challenges to patients, impacting various aspects of their health. Two critical areas of concern for individuals with CKD are iron absorption and kidney health. Fortunately, there is a powerful ally in the form of vitamin C-rich foods that can offer support in both these areas. In this article, we will explore the role of foods rich in vitamin C for enhancing iron absorption and supporting kidney health in CKD. By understanding how vitamin C functions in the body, CKD patients can make informed dietary choices to improve their overall well-being.


1, Enhancing Iron Absorption.

vitamin C plays a crucial role in enhancing the absorption of non-heme iron, which is the type of iron found in plant-based foods and iron supplements. This is particularly important for individuals with chronic kidney disease who often experience anemia due to reduced erythropoietin production and impaired iron absorption.



Including foods rich in vitamin C in the diet can be beneficial for chronic kidney disease  patients to help increase iron absorption and improve anemia management. Citrus fruits such as oranges, lemons, and grapefruits are excellent sources of vitamin C. Additionally, strawberries, bell peppers, and kiwi are also good choices to incorporate into the diet.


When consumed alongside plant-based iron sources or iron supplements, the vitamin C in these foods can enhance the absorption of non-heme iron. This is because vitamin C helps convert non-heme iron into a more easily absorbable form by reducing it from its ferric state to the ferrous state. By doing so, it improves the overall iron absorption from plant-based foods and iron supplements.

2, Antioxidant Protection.

chronic kidney disease  patients are indeed prone to oxidative stress, which is an imbalance between free radicals and antioxidants in the body. This condition can lead to cellular damage and contribute to the progression of kidney disease.


Vitamin C plays a crucial role in combating oxidative stress as a potent antioxidant. It helps neutralize harmful free radicals by donating an electron to stabilize them, thereby protecting cells from oxidative damage. By doing so, vitamin C helps reduce inflammation and oxidative stress in the kidneys, which can be beneficial for individuals with chronic kidney disease .



Including foods high in vitamin C in the diet can contribute to antioxidant protection and support kidney health in chronic kidney disease  patients. Citrus fruits like oranges, lemons, and grapefruits, as well as strawberries, bell peppers, and kiwi, are excellent sources of vitamin C and can be incorporated into a kidney-friendly diet.


It's important to note that while vitamin C can provide antioxidant benefits, chronic kidney disease  patients should be mindful of their overall nutrient intake, including vitamin C. In advanced stages of chronic kidney disease , the kidneys may have difficulty processing and excreting excess vitamin C, which can lead to elevated levels in the blood. 3, Collagen Formation.

Vitamin C plays a vital role in collagen synthesis, which is crucial for maintaining the integrity and strength of various tissues in the body, including blood vessels and kidney structures.


In chronic kidney disease , the progressive decline in kidney function can lead to structural abnormalities and damage to blood vessels and kidney tissues. Collagen, a structural protein, is essential for maintaining the integrity and function of these structures. Vitamin C is necessary for the hydroxylation of proline and lysine residues in collagen synthesis, which helps stabilize the collagen triple helix structure and promote proper collagen formation.



By ensuring an adequate intake of vitamin C, chronic kidney disease  patients can support collagen production, which aids in maintaining healthy blood vessels and kidney tissues. This is important for preserving the integrity of the kidney's filtration system, reducing the risk of complications associated with vascular damage, and supporting overall kidney health.

4, Acid Balance.

chronic kidney disease can lead to imbalanced acid-base levels in the body, it's important to note that the effect of vitamin C on acid-base balance is not straightforward.


Although vitamin C is often considered an acidic compound due to its chemical properties, it has a negligible impact on the overall acid-base balance when consumed as part of a balanced diet. The body has robust mechanisms for maintaining acid-base equilibrium, primarily through the kidneys and lungs.



In chronic kidney disease , the kidneys' ability to regulate acid-base balance is compromised, which can result in metabolic acidosis. Metabolic acidosis is characterized by an excess of acid in the blood, leading to a decrease in blood pH. While certain fruits and vegetables, including those rich in vitamin C, may be acidic in nature, they are metabolized by the body into substances that have an alkalizing effect, such as bicarbonate ions.


However, it's essential to keep in mind that the alkalizing effect of vitamin C-rich foods is relatively minor compared to other factors that influence acid-base balance in chronic kidney disease . The primary treatment for metabolic acidosis in chronic kidney disease  involves specific interventions such as sodium bicarbonate supplementation or dietary modifications under the guidance of healthcare professionals.

5, Immune Function.

chronic kidney disease  patients often have compromised immune systems, which can increase their susceptibility to infections. Vitamin C plays a significant role in supporting immune function and can be beneficial for individuals with chronic kidney disease .


Vitamin C is known for its immune-enhancing properties. It stimulates the production and activity of various immune cells, including white blood cells such as lymphocytes and phagocytes, which are essential for fighting off pathogens and maintaining a strong immune response.


By consuming foods rich in vitamin C, chronic kidney disease  patients can help bolster their immune system and potentially reduce the risk of infections. Citrus fruits like oranges, lemons, and grapefruits, as well as strawberries, bell peppers, and kiwi, are excellent sources of vitamin C that can be incorporated into a kidney-friendly diet.
